gawk
To stare like a gom — mouth open, no shame.
Definitions
To stare openly, usually rudely or stupidly. Common across Britain and Ireland but particularly Irish-flavoured — often paired with 'at' and aimed at someone making a holy show of themselves. Suggests the gawker looks a bit thick while doing it.
